Timing analysis of scenario‐based specifications using linear programming

Abstract: SUMMARYScenario‐based specifications (SBSs), such as UML interaction models, offer an intuitive and visual way of describing design requirements, and are playing an increasingly important role in the design of software systems. This paper presents an approach to timing analysis of SBSs expressed by UML interaction models.
